Ingredient List
- Enriched Bleached Flour (bleached Wheat Flour
- Niacin*
- Reduced Iron
- Thiamin Mononitrate*
- Riboflavin*
- Folic Acid*)
- Palm Oil
- Salt
- Corn Syrup Solids
- Whey
- Sodium Aluminum Phosphate
- Dextrose
- Sodium Bicarbonate
- Calcium Phosphate
- Calcium Carbonate
- Mono And Diglycerides
- L-cysteine *one Of The B Vitamins

Quaker Harina Preparada White Flour Tortilla Mix 20 Pound Paper Bag, Unprepared Nutritional Value
Nutrient | Suggested Serving 0.33 Cup (41 g) (41 g) | Standard Serving 100g |
---|---|---|
Protein | 3.56 g (3%) | 8.68 g (7%) |
Total Lipid (fat) | 4.94 g (3%) | 12.05 g (8%) |
Carbohydrate, By Difference | 26.8 g (4%) | 65.37 g (9%) |
Fiber, Total Dietary | 0.9 g (1%) | 2.3 g (4%) |
Sugars, Total | 0.6 g (1%) | 1.47 g (2%) |
Calcium, Ca | 65 mg (2%) | 159 mg (5%) |
Iron, Fe | 1.62 mg (4%) | 3.96 mg (9%) |
Sodium, Na | 375 mg (6%) | 915 mg (16%) |
Vitamin C, Total Ascorbic Acid | 0 mg (0%) | 0 mg (0%) |
Thiamin | 0.41 mg (14%) | 1 mg (34%) |
Niacin | 2.01 mg (5%) | 4.91 mg (13%) |
Folate, Total | 52 µg (5%) | 128 µg (13%) |
Folic Acid | 52 µg (0%) | 128 µg (0%) |
Vitamin A, Iu | 0 IU (0%) | 1 IU (0%) |
Fatty Acids, Total Saturated | 2.3 g (5%) | 5.62 g (12%) |
Fatty Acids, Total Monounsaturated | 1.88 g (0%) | 4.58 g (0%) |
Fatty Acids, Total Polyunsaturated | 0.59 g (0%) | 1.44 g (0%) |
Fatty Acids, Total Trans | 0 g (0%) | 0 g (0%) |
Cholesterol | 0 mg (0%) | 0 mg (0%) |

Dietary Recommendations
A healthy eating pattern that accounts for all foods and beverages within an appropriate calorie level could help achieve and maintain a healthy weight and reduce the risk of chronic disease. Healthy eating habits include the following:
- Vegetables from all subgroups, including dark, green, red and orange vegetables and also beans and peas
- A variety of whole fruits
- Grains with at least half of which are whole grains
- Low or fat free dairy products, including milk, yogurt, cheese and/or fortified soy beverages
- Protein foods, including seafood, lean meats and poultry, eggs and nuts
- Oils with limited amounts of saturated fats and trans fats, added sugars, and sodium
